Invalid Views. Views of Unruly videos must result from genuine user interest. Any method that artificially generates views of your Unruly videos is strictly prohibited. These prohibited methods include but are not limited to repeated manual views, using robots, automated view generating tools, third-party services that generate view such as paid-to-view, paid-to-surf or any deceptive software. Failure to comply with this policy may lead to your account being disabled.
Prohibited Content. Publishers in the Unruly Media Programme may only place Unruly Media videos on sites that adhere to our content guidelines. Sites displaying Unruly Media videos may not include, without limitation, the following types of prohibited content ("Prohibited Content")
- Violent content, racial intolerance or advocacy against any individual, group or organisation
- Pornography, adult or mature content
- Hacking/cracking content
- Illicit drugs and drug paraphernalia
- Excessive profanity
- Facilitation or promotion of illegal file sharing
- Sales or promotion of weapons or ammunition (e.g. firearms, fighting knives, stun guns)
- Sales or promotion of tobacco or tobacco-related products
- Sales or promotion of prescription drugs
- Sales or promotion of products that are replicas or imitations of designer goods
- Sales or distribution of term papers or student essays
- Any other content that is illegal, promotes illegal activity or infringes on the legal rights of others
Copyrighted Material. Website publishers may not display Unruly videos on web pages with content protected by copyright law unless they have the necessary legal rights to display that content.
Site and Video Behaviour.
- Sites showing Unruly videos should be easy for users to navigate and should not contain excessive pop-ups.
- Sites showing Unruly videos may not contain pop-ups or pop-unders that interfere with site navigation, change user preferences or initiate downloads.
- Unruly Media code may not be altered, nor may standard video behaviour be manipulated in any way that is not explicitly permitted by Unruly Media.
- Any Unruly Media code must be pasted directly into web pages without modification. Unruly Media participants are not allowed to alter any portion of the code or change the behaviour, targeting or delivery of videos.
- A site or third party cannot display our videos as a result of the actions of any software application such as a toolbar.
- No Unruly Media code may be integrated into a software application.
- Web pages containing Unruly Media code may not be loaded by any software that can trigger pop-ups, redirect users to unwanted websites, modify browser settings or otherwise interfere with site navigation.
Video Placement. Unruly Media offers a number of video formats. Publishers are encouraged to experiment with a variety of placements, provided the following policies are respected:
- Up to three video units may be displayed on each page.
- No Unruly Media video may be displayed in a pop-up, pop-under or in an email.
- Elements on a page must not obscure any portion of the videos.
- No Unruly Media video may be placed on any non-content-based pages.
